Understanding the Purpose of Floor Wax

Before diving into the maintenance procedures, it is vital to understand what floor wax actually does. The primary function of a wax finish is to seal the porous surface of the flooring, creating a protective barrier against moisture, dirt, and physical abrasion. This sealant prevents staining and makes routine cleaning significantly easier, as spills can be wiped away before they penetrate the material. Furthermore, the glossy finish enhances the color and depth of the concrete or stone, giving the entire area a polished and well-maintained appearance.

The Role of Buffing in Wax Integrity

Buffing is not merely a cosmetic step; it is a critical maintenance function that rejuvenates the wax layer. Over time, the glossy surface becomes dull due to oxidation and the abrasive forces of foot traffic. Buffing the floor applies heat and friction, which melts the top layers of wax and fills in minor scratches. This process restores the shine and creates a smoother surface, reducing friction and making the floor easier to clean. Regular buffing cycles are the difference between a floor that looks worn and one that retains a like-new luster.

Implementing a Daily Cleaning Routine

Daily maintenance is the first line of defense against premature wear. The goal here is to remove surface dust and grit that, if left unchecked, will act like sandpaper and dull the wax finish. Sweeping or vacuuming is insufficient on its own; a damp mop is necessary to capture the finer particles that attract dirt.

Use a neutral-pH cleaning solution specifically designed for sealed floors. Avoid harsh alkaline cleaners or acid-based products, as these can strip the wax layer or damage the substrate. The cleaning solution should be applied evenly, and the floor should be dried promptly with a clean towel or by air circulation to prevent water spots or streaking.

Establishing a Deep Maintenance Schedule

While daily care handles surface-level debris, deep maintenance addresses the buildup that accumulates over weeks and months. This involves a process called "screening" or "de-waxing," where the old, oxidized wax is removed down to a clean, porous layer. This is typically done using a stripping solution and a stiff pad on a buffer machine.

After the old wax is completely removed, the floor must be thoroughly cleaned and allowed to dry completely. Only then should a new coat of high-quality floor wax be applied. Applying wax to a dirty or damp floor will result in poor adhesion, leading to peeling and uneven finishes in a matter of days.

Practical Tips for High-Traffic Areas

In hallways, lobbies, and entrances, the wax endures the most abuse. These areas require more frequent attention than low-traffic offices or bedrooms. Consider implementing a quarterly maintenance schedule for these zones, or install high-quality entrance matting to trap excess moisture and soil before it reaches the waxed surface. Additionally, using felt pads on the bottom of furniture legs prevents unsightly scuffs and indentations that compromise the integrity of the wax.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Even with diligent care, problems can arise. White spots or haze usually indicate a buildup of hard water minerals or soap residue. This can typically be resolved with a thorough cleaning using a specialized remover or a mixture of vinegar and water. If the floor becomes sticky after cleaning, it is a sign that the wrong cleaning product was used, or too much wax was applied. Sticky floors require stripping back to the bare concrete and starting the waxing process anew with a lighter, more manageable coat.
